A faulty oxygen sensor is one of the most common causes of a check engine light. Symptoms may include a decrease in fuel mileage, hesitation or misfiring from the engine, rough idling or even stalling. A faulty sensor may cause the vehicle to fail an emissions test.
Any time there is an emissions fault the check engine light will be displayed. The purpose of the check engine light is to inform the driver that an emission related fault has been found, and that there are on-board diagnostic (OBD) trouble codes stored in the powertrain or engine control module. Additionally, since the emissions systems are so intertwined into engine control and transmission control systems, symptoms may include nearly any sort of drivability concerns. This may include harsh shifting, failure to shift, hesitation on acceleration, jerking, engine failure to start or run, loss of power, or any number of other drivability issues.
Due to the nature of electrical systems on modern vehicles, the range of problems these can cause are nearly limitless. However, there is a way to categorize them in two ways. Permanent and intermittent problems. Permanent problems appear and remain. This may be the vehicle will not start, the radio does not work, or the door chime will not turn off among many, many others. These problems are more straight-forward to diagnose since they present themselves at all time. This means there will always be a fault to find. Intermittent electrical problems, however, can be difficult or impossible to locate, since they appear then disappear without warning. The best case scenario for an intermittent issue is when replicating the problem is easily accomplished and understood. This allows a technician to make an issue semi-permanent, allowing them to find the fault. Other issues that come and go without warning and cannot be replicated on demand must occur when the technician is servicing the vehicle, otherwise there is no problem to correct. It is most important to understand that electrical system faults always require inspection, and can include the vehicle working in any manner, or not working at all.

When the Check Engine Light comes on, you may experience engine performance issues such as poor acceleration, rough idling, or an engine that won't start. In some cases, no abnormal symptoms will be experienced. Other systems like the transmission or ABS can cause the Check Engine Light to illuminate and lights for those systems can come on at the same time. Similar lights may say "Check Engine Soon", "Malfunction Indicator Light" or just "Check". In rare case the engine can overheat.
When faced with a check engine light on your 2006 Honda CR-V, it's essential to approach the diagnosis methodically. Start by checking the gas cap; a loose or damaged cap is a common culprit that can easily trigger the light. Next, take a moment to inspect your dashboard gauges for any additional warning lights or unusual readings, as these can offer further insights into the problem. If the light persists, using an OBD-II scanner is a crucial step; this tool will provide you with specific error codes that can help you identify the underlying issue more accurately. Additionally, examining the condition of your spark plugs is vital, as worn or faulty plugs can significantly impact engine performance. Lastly, inspect the vacuum hoses for any signs of cracks or leaks, as these components are integral to your engine's operation. By following these initial diagnostic steps, you can effectively gather the necessary information to address the check engine light and potentially resolve the issue on your own.
When the check engine light illuminates in a 2006 Honda CR-V, it serves as a crucial alert that something may be amiss under the hood. One of the most common reasons for this warning is a loose or damaged gas cap, which can disrupt the fuel system's pressure and trigger the light. Another frequent issue is a faulty oxygen sensor, which not only activates the check engine light but can also lead to decreased fuel efficiency if left unaddressed. Additionally, problems with the catalytic converter, such as inefficiency or failure, can indicate potential emissions issues and cause the light to illuminate. Spark plug or ignition coil malfunctions are also known to trigger the check engine light, as they are essential for proper engine operation. Furthermore, a malfunctioning mass airflow sensor can significantly affect the vehicle's performance and lead to the warning light being activated. Lastly, a faulty Exhaust Gas Recirculation (EGR) valve can impact emissions and trigger the check engine light as well. If you find yourself facing this warning, it is advisable to have your vehicle diagnosed by a qualified mechanic to accurately identify the issue and prevent further complications.
